Understanding the Appeal of Stainless Steel

Stainless steel’s enduring popularity in kitchen sink manufacturing is no accident. Its inherent properties make it an ideal material for this high-traffic area. Firstly, stainless steel is exceptionally durable, resisting scratches, dents, and stains far better than many alternative materials. This longevity translates to a longer lifespan for your sink, saving you money in the long run. Secondly, stainless steel is remarkably hygienic. Its non-porous surface prevents the growth of bacteria and mold, contributing to a cleaner and healthier kitchen environment. Cleaning is also a breeze; a simple wipe-down is often sufficient to maintain its pristine condition; Finally, stainless steel boasts a timeless, elegant aesthetic that complements a wide range of kitchen designs, from modern minimalist to rustic farmhouse styles.

The Advantages of a Double Bowl Sink

The double bowl configuration offers unparalleled versatility and efficiency in the kitchen. Two separate basins provide ample space for multitasking, allowing you to simultaneously soak dirty dishes in one bowl while rinsing vegetables or prepping food in the other. This significantly streamlines the cleaning process, reducing the time and effort required for dishwashing. Moreover, the division of space helps to keep the sink organized, preventing the accumulation of dirty dishes and food scraps.

Different Sizes and Configurations

Double bowl sinks are available in a wide array of sizes and configurations, catering to various kitchen layouts and needs. Larger sinks offer more space for larger pots and pans, while smaller sinks might be more suitable for smaller kitchens. The ratio of bowl sizes also varies; some models feature two equally sized bowls, while others offer a larger primary bowl and a smaller secondary bowl for utility tasks. Consider the dimensions of your countertop and your typical washing needs when selecting the appropriate size and configuration.

Depth Considerations: Why “Deep” Matters

The depth of a sink is a crucial factor influencing its practicality. Deep bowls prevent water from splashing onto the countertop, keeping your kitchen cleaner and minimizing the risk of water damage. They also provide ample space for soaking larger items like baking sheets or bulky cookware. A deeper sink allows for more efficient cleaning, especially when dealing with larger, dirtier dishes.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

Installing a double bowl stainless steel sink typically involves removing the old sink, preparing the countertop for the new sink, and securing the sink in place using appropriate sealant and fasteners. While this task is manageable for experienced DIYers, hiring a professional plumber is often recommended to ensure a proper and leak-free installation. Regular maintenance involves cleaning the sink with mild soap and water, avoiding abrasive cleaners that can scratch the surface. Addressing minor scratches promptly can prevent them from becoming more noticeable over time.

  • Always use non-abrasive cleaning agents.
  • Avoid using steel wool or harsh scouring pads.
  • Dry the sink thoroughly after each use to prevent water spots.
  • Regularly inspect the sink for any signs of damage or leaks.

Comparing Deep Double Bowl Sinks to Other Options

While deep double bowl stainless steel sinks are a popular choice, it’s crucial to compare them to other options available in the market. Consider composite granite sinks, which offer a different aesthetic and are also resistant to scratches and stains. Cast iron sinks provide exceptional durability but are significantly heavier. Undermount sinks provide a sleek, integrated look, whereas drop-in sinks offer a simpler installation process. The best choice depends on your individual needs and preferences.

Exploring Different Finishes and Styles

Stainless steel sinks come in various finishes, each impacting their appearance and maintenance requirements. A satin finish offers a subtle sheen, while a polished finish has a high-gloss look. Matte finishes are becoming increasingly popular for their modern aesthetic and their ability to disguise water spots. Choosing a finish that complements your kitchen’s overall style is essential. Consider the overall design of your kitchen when selecting the perfect finish for your sink.

Choosing the Right Finish for Your Kitchen Style

The choice between a satin, polished, or matte finish is a matter of personal preference. A satin finish is classic and understated, while a polished finish adds a touch of luxury. A matte finish gives a more contemporary feel. Think about the overall feel you want to achieve in your kitchen when making your selection. For a modern kitchen, a matte finish might be ideal, while a more traditional setting might benefit from a satin or polished finish.
